Product Overview of IBM 00FN148
The IBM 00FN148 is a 4TB nearline hard drive designed for use in enterprise-level data storage systems. It is a 3.5-inch form factor drive with a SATA 6Gbps interface and a spindle speed of 7.2K RPM. The 00FN148 also features 512e sector technology, which enables it to store more data in a smaller physical space, making it a cost-effective and space-efficient storage solution.
SATA 6GBPS Interface
The 00FN148 is equipped with a SATA 6Gbps interface, which is a high-speed data transfer protocol that allows for fast data transfer rates between the hard drive and the host system. This interface is also backward compatible with earlier versions of the SATA protocol, so the 00FN148 can be used with older systems as well.
3.5-inch Form Factor
The 00FN148 is designed to fit into a standard 3.5-inch drive bay, which is a common size for enterprise-level data storage systems. This form factor is preferred because it allows for a larger amount of storage capacity to be housed in a relatively small physical space, making it a more efficient use of space in data centers.
7.2K RPM Spindle Speed
The 00FN148 has a spindle speed of 7.2K RPM, which means that the platters inside the drive rotate at a rate of 7,200 revolutions per minute. This fast rotation speed allows the drive to access data quickly, making it a good choice for applications that require fast read and write speeds.

Simple Swap Design
The 00FN148 is designed with a Simple Swap feature, which allows for easy hot-swapping of the drive without shutting down the system. This feature is particularly useful in enterprise-level data storage systems where downtime must be minimized as much as possible.
Nearline Hard Drive
The 00FN148 is a nearline hard drive, which is a type of hard drive that is designed for use in applications where data access speeds are not critical, but large amounts of data need to be stored and accessed relatively quickly. Nearline hard drives are often used in backup and archiving systems, where data is stored for long periods of time and needs to be accessed quickly when needed.
